The Color Factory is an interactive "museum" and "instagrammable".  There are
something like 15 rooms each with its own color theme and activity.  Each room is beautiful and great for taking selfies but at the beginning of the museum they also give you a card to scan.  In a lot of the rooms, there are photo booths set up so you can take hands free photos!  Each of the photos is then sent to your email address so you can have them whenever you want.
The Color Factory is a pop up museum so it's only in Manhattan until September 30!
